LeBron James: The King's Reign Continues
Let's be real, guys, when you're talking about the Lakers vs. Rockets player stats, you simply cannot start without acknowledging LeBron James. The King, as always, put on a clinic, proving yet again why he's one of the greatest to ever grace the hardwood. His stat line for the night was nothing short of spectacular, an all-around masterclass that showcased his incredible versatility and enduring impact on the game. LeBron clocked in with a stunning 32 points, 11 assists, and 8 rebounds, just shy of another triple-double, which is pretty much par for the course for him, right? But it wasn't just the raw numbers; it was how he got them. He shot an incredibly efficient 13-for-22 from the field, including 3-for-6 from beyond the arc, demonstrating his ability to score from anywhere on the court. His playmaking was equally impressive, as he consistently found teammates in prime scoring positions, making the game easier for everyone around him. Those 11 assists weren't just simple passes; they were dime-dropping, defense-dismantling plays that led directly to high-percentage shots. Furthermore, his eight rebounds showcased his commitment on the glass, battling with bigger, younger players to secure possessions and kickstart fast breaks. Defensively, he was engaged, tallying 2 steals and 1 block, disrupting the Rockets' rhythm and reminding everyone that he can still impact both ends of the floor at an elite level. Anthony Davis: The Brow's Impact on Both Ends
Moving on from the King, let's shine a much-deserved spotlight on Anthony Davis, because his performance against the Rockets was, frankly, unreal. When we dig into the Lakers vs. Rockets player stats, AD's impact jumps right off the page, proving he's not just a scoring threat but a defensive anchor and a rebounding machine. Anthony Davis absolutely dominated, dropping a monster 28 points, grabbing 15 rebounds, and adding a crucial 4 blocks and 2 steals. Now, those aren't just good numbers; those are elite, game-changing numbers that demonstrate his incredible presence on both ends of the court. On offense, he was a force in the paint, converting crucial buckets and drawing fouls, shooting an excellent 11-for-18 from the field. His ability to score inside, knock down mid-range jumpers, and even stretch the floor occasionally made him a nightmare matchup for the Rockets' bigs. But where he truly shone was defensively. Those 15 rebounds weren't just accumulating; they were often contested boards that limited the Rockets to single-shot possessions, crucial in maintaining the Lakers' lead. And let's talk about those 4 blocks! He was a veritable shot-swatting machine, protecting the rim with ferocity and altering countless other attempts, completely disrupting the Rockets' offensive rhythm and confidence when driving to the basket. His 2 steals further highlighted his quick hands and defensive instincts, turning defense into offense on multiple occasions.
